Fisheries exports estimated at US$1.85 billion in Q1
Fisheries exports estimated at US$1.85 billion in Q1

Fisheries export value was estimated at US$1.85 billion in the first quarter (Q1) of this year, a fall of 27% compared to the same period last year due to lower consumption and import demand under the impacts of inflation and economic recession, according to the Vietnam Association of Seafood Exporters and Producers (VASEP).

Key Vietnamese agro-forestry-aquatic exports plummet
Key Vietnamese agro-forestry-aquatic exports plummet

VOV.VN - Vietnam’s export of several key agro-forestry-aquatic products endured a sharp drop on the impact of rising inflation globally, causing its first-quarter export turnover to decline by 14.4% year on year to US$11.2 billion, according to the Ministry of Agriculture and Rural Development (MARD).

Vietnamese rice export prices on the rise globally
Vietnamese rice export prices on the rise globally

VOV.VN - The export price of Vietnamese rice in the first quarter of the year recorded an annual rise of 9.2% on average to reach US$531 per tonne, according to the Ministry of Agriculture and Rural Development (MARD).
